What is the scientific name of pinta-amarela?
The scientific name of pinta-amarela is Chrysomphalus dictyospermi. It belongs to the genus Chrysomphalus.
Where does pinta-amarela live?
pinta-amarela is found in Widely distributed across Asia (Japan, Taiwan), Europe (20 countries), and North America (United States).. Countries include Albania, Belgium, Bulgaria, Croatia, Czech Republic, Denmark, France, Germany, Greece, Hungary.
What family does pinta-amarela belong to?
pinta-amarela (Chrysomphalus dictyospermi) belongs to the genus Chrysomphalus, which is part of the taxonomic family Diaspididae.
What kingdom does pinta-amarela belong to?
pinta-amarela (Chrysomphalus dictyospermi) belongs to the kingdom Animalia (Animals).
